St Andrew Church - Holborn

A Timeless Sanctuary Reimagined

St Andrew Holborn, a Grade I listed church, has been a beacon of solace in the heart of London for over a millennium.

Reduced to ruins during WWII, it was meticulously rebuilt in 1961, honouring Christopher Wren’s original 17th-century design. As a guild church without a designated parish, in the post war era it faced dwindling visitor numbers and fell into disrepair.

Shortlisted for a RIBA London Award – the innovative restoration with sustainability at its core incorporated the use of healthy materials, energy-efficient fixtures, and natural ventilation, ensuring comfort year-round.

The new baptistery chapel features a font set over a rediscovered spring in the former crypt. Enriching christenings with natural water. A decluttered interior adorned with white and pale hues offer a serene light-filled haven and the new stone, diamond-patterned, floor with repurposed pews provide an engaging flexible multi-purpose space for events.

Hosting services, hospitality events,  meetings and conferences means the church is economically thriving since the restoration and can continue to welcome visitors who can also purchase gifts and merchandise from the retail shop.
